Major Denton County, Texas Real Estate Markets

The county's real estate landscape centers around several key markets, each with distinct characteristics and buyer demographics. Frisco, Plano, and The Colony represent the southern tier's high-growth suburban corridor, featuring master-planned communities and luxury developments that appeal to affluent families seeking top-rated schools and corporate proximity. Meanwhile, Denton itself serves as the county seat and university town, offering a unique blend of historic neighborhoods, student housing, and family-friendly subdivisions that create diverse investment opportunities.

Northern communities like Flower Mound, Lewisville, and Little Elm have emerged as particularly sought-after destinations, combining lakefront properties along Lewisville Lake with established neighborhoods and new construction. These areas often surprise newcomers with their small-town feel despite being within easy commuting distance of major corporate headquarters, creating a premium market for homes that offer both tranquility and accessibility.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Denton County's real estate market operates on multiple levels simultaneously, with luxury estates in Trophy Club coexisting alongside starter homes in Aubrey and investment properties near UNT campus. This geographic complexity means agents must understand vastly different price points, buyer motivations, and local regulations within a single county. Properties can range from sprawling ranch estates to contemporary townhomes, often within just a few miles of each other.

The market's resilience stems partly from its economic diversity – while many North Texas counties rely heavily on corporate relocations, Denton County benefits from university stability, local business growth, and its position as a desirable destination for Texas natives seeking quality of life improvements. This creates consistent demand across multiple property types and price ranges, supported by strong job growth in education, healthcare, and technology sectors.
